A melhor implementação de tecnologias de IA em GPUs
Quando se trata da implementação de tecnologias de Inteligência Artificial em Unidades de Processamento Gráfico (GPUs), é essencial considerar diversos fatores. Desde a escolha dos algoritmos mais adequados até a otimização do hardware, cada etapa desempenha um papel crucial no desempenho final do sistema.
Algoritmos de IA otimizados para GPUs
Os algoritmos de IA utilizados em GPUs devem ser cuidadosamente selecionados e otimizados para garantir a melhor performance. Algoritmos como redes neurais convolucionais (CNNs) e redes neurais recorrentes (RNNs) são frequentemente utilizados devido à sua eficiência no processamento de dados complexos.
Otimização de Hardware para IA em GPUs
A otimização do hardware é essencial para garantir que as GPUs sejam capazes de lidar com as demandas computacionais da IA. Isso inclui a escolha de placas gráficas com alta capacidade de processamento, memória RAM suficiente e uma boa refrigeração para evitar o superaquecimento.
Integração de Software e Hardware
A integração eficiente entre o software de IA e o hardware das GPUs é fundamental para garantir um desempenho otimizado. Isso envolve a configuração adequada dos drivers da placa gráfica, a instalação de bibliotecas de IA e a realização de testes de desempenho para garantir a estabilidade do sistema.
Desafios na Implementação de IA em GPUs
Apesar dos benefícios da implementação de IA em GPUs, existem desafios a serem superados. Questões como a escalabilidade do sistema, a segurança dos dados e a interoperabilidade com outras tecnologias podem impactar o sucesso da implementação.
Benefícios da Implementação de IA em GPUs
A implementação bem-sucedida de tecnologias de IA em GPUs pode trazer inúmeros benefícios, incluindo maior eficiência computacional, capacidade de processamento paralelo e aceleração de tarefas complexas. Esses benefícios podem impulsionar a inovação em diversos setores.
Considerações Finais
Em suma, a melhor implementação de tecnologias de IA em GPUs requer uma abordagem holística que leve em consideração tanto os aspectos técnicos quanto os práticos. Ao seguir as melhores práticas e realizar testes rigorosos, é possível alcançar um desempenho excepcional nesse campo em constante evolução.